NOT your usual 'Aloo Paratha'


'Dabeli', has all my favorite flavors and ingredients packed up in small but delicious package! So here is ...Another innovation in my favorite world of Dabeli :)



Here is a short recipe:
Mash boiled potatoes, add 'Dabeli masala' very finely chopped dried cranberries, salt and red chili powder and mix. While making Parathas stuff this mixture in the dough along with very finely minced onion, cilantro and some thin Sev. Roll paratha and roast till slightly brown. Serve with tamarind chutney!!

And now presenting the beautiful ...Dabeli rolls:

Ingredients:
Fillings and fixings of Dabeli
http://my-kitchens-aroma.blogspot.com/2009/11/chatpata-chaat-kutchi-dabeli.html

1 Store bought Biscuit dough can (Buttermilk or plain)



Method:
1) Roll out the biscuit dough on little flour into oval shape with a rolling pin. Apply Tamarind-Jaggery/date Chutney and put the fillings in the center.
Cut the sides as shown at an angle.


2) Fold the alternate edges on to each other as shown to make the pattern.Press gently to seal edges.


3) Bake on baking sheet as directed on biscuit dough can till golden brown
